What is the average price of a house in Cotswold?

The average price for a house in Cotswold is £641k, costing on average £621 per sqft.

Average prices of houses by bedroom count are: £339k for a two-bedroom, £487k for a three-bedroom, £715k for a four-bedroom, and £1.06m for a five-bedroom.

What share of houses in Cotswold feature gardens and parking?

In Cotswold, 94% of houses have a garden and 91% include parking.

What is the breakdown of property types in Cotswold?

The housing mix in Cotswold is 48% detached, 28% semi-detached, 15% terraced, and 9% other.

What is the most expensive area in Cotswold to buy a home?

The most expensive area to buy a house in Cotswold is GL55, where the average property is £907k. The second and third most expensive areas are OX7 with an average price of £778k and GL9 with an average price of £758k .

What is the cheapest area in Cotswold to buy a home?

The cheapest area to buy a house in Cotswold is GL4, where the average property is £358k. The second and third cheapest areas are WR11 with an average price of £415k and SN6 with an average price of £491k .

What is the average price of a flat in Cotswold?

The average price for a flat in Cotswold is £229k, costing on average £312 per sqft.

Average prices of flats by bedroom count are: £156k for a one-bedroom, £230k for a two-bedroom, £482k for a three-bedroom, and £641k for a four-bedroom.

What share of flats in Cotswold feature balconies and parking?

In Cotswold, 10% of flats have a balcony and 88% include parking.

What is the breakdown of lease types in Cotswold?

The leasing mix in Cotswold is 94% leasehold and 6% freehold.

What is the most expensive area in Cotswold to buy a flat?

The most expensive area to buy a flat in Cotswold is GL55, where the average property is £390k. The second and third most expensive areas are GL54 with an average price of £330k and GL8 with an average price of £274k .

What is the cheapest area in Cotswold to buy a flat?

The cheapest area to buy a flat in Cotswold is WR11, where the average property is £136k. The second and third cheapest areas are GL4 with an average price of £150k and SN6 with an average price of £153k .
